Abstract
We investigate the differential cross sections for antiproton-impact ionization of H atoms within the framework of time-dependent close-coupling theory. A Fourier transform method is employed in order to extract the fully differential cross sections for a specific value of projectile momentum transfer. The method allows us to incorporate the information about the interaction between the incoming projectile and the target nucleus, the so-called nucleus-nucleus interaction, and to assess its effect on the fully differential cross sections and double differential cross sections in projectile variables.
